www3566.com Server iP:
Current resolution:
domain resolution record:
2025-06-06-----2026-02-20 148.135.3.91
2024-10-11-----2025-06-08 221.228.32.13
2024-10-31-----2025-05-19 148.135.3.93
2024-06-21-----2024-11-10 0.0.0.0
2024-10-17-----2024-10-31 183.192.65.101
2024-09-15-----2024-10-17 74.48.7.158
2024-08-15-----2024-09-15 124.236.16.201
2023-12-06-----2024-08-15 148.135.97.67
2024-06-27-----2024-07-24 183.213.92.2
2024-06-27-----2024-07-24 106.74.25.198
2024-06-27-----2024-07-24 182.43.124.6
2024-06-01-----2024-06-01 61.160.148.90
2022-09-29-----2023-10-19 216.127.163.89
2023-10-18-----2023-10-18 156.234.127.116
2023-09-22-----2023-09-22 156.234.127.27
2022-09-13-----2022-09-13 154.94.139.147
2022-08-18-----2022-08-24 23.224.16.203
2021-11-16-----2022-08-04 198.211.39.21
2021-03-06-----2021-10-22 154.91.184.16
2020-12-16-----2020-12-26 107.151.227.97
- website server lookup history
- laixi.tongcheng8.com
- hengshui.yangshitianqi.com
- 944881.com
- www.cffdc.com
- 23432.51l5.com
- xuian.com
- 12315hr.cc
- www.ecolojeux.com
- xyj388.com
- sjdqnq.com
- www.wifihell.com
- qm2025.cc
- xiang123.com
- aa.zhujia2.com
- www.kanglicn.com
- chahaotai.com
- 5x87.com
- www.k4op8m.com
- www.ikucul.com
- www.yp.com
- hosting ip address lookup history
- 59.37.160.45
- 120.224.211.7
- 172.247.136.85
- 47.246.23.203
- 104.243.140.31
- 156.254.147.236
- 58.56.63.214
- 149.104.43.132
- 45.193.210.27
- 43.229.38.111
- 139.224.57.147
- 185.10.48.197
- 104.21.52.118
- 18.193.207.204
- 107.164.121.55
- 99.83.142.211
- 185.110.51.226
- 207.148.32.243
- 184.51.195.202
- 23.220.167.137
